Moga: With three more incidents of braid-cutting being reported in the state, the police continued to remain clueless about such cases.  A 55-year-old woman hailing from Mandheke village in Moga has alleged that her hair was chopped off on the intervening night of Saturday and Sunday. 

Angrej Kaur’s husband Gurmel Singh said when she woke up on Sunday, she found her hair chopped off. She fainted and was admitted to a local hospital.  Gurmail told the police the gate of his house was locked on Saturday night, but it was found opened in the morning. Initially, the police suspected that her husband had cut her hair. Nihalsinghwala police station SHO Ravinder Singh said investigations were in progress.

Another incident was reported in the town where a woman, residing in New Vijay Nagar, claimed that her braid had been chopped off on Saturday night. Ram Prtavesh, a native of Samastipur district in Bihar, said his wife Janaki Devi found her hair chopped off when she woke up in the morning. 

Later, she became unconscious and her family members took her to a “godman” suspecting her to be in the grip of some “evil spirit”. But when her condition deteriorated, she was admitted  to the local Civil Hospital. Doctors said she was anaemic.
